What is a credit risk model validation quantitative analyst?

A Credit Risk Model Validation Quantitative Analyst is a finance professional responsible for assessing and validating the accuracy, reliability, and performance of credit risk models used by financial institutions. Their work involves reviewing statistical methods, testing model assumptions, and ensuring compliance with regulatory requirements. By identifying model weaknesses and recommending improvements, they help institutions manage risk effectively and maintain sound lending practices.

What are the key skills and qualifications needed to thrive as a credit risk model validation quantitative analyst?

To thrive as a Credit Risk Model Validation Quantitative Analyst, you need a solid background in quantitative finance, statistics, and programming, often supported by an advanced degree in a quantitative field. Proficiency with statistical software such as Python, R, SAS, and familiarity with regulatory frameworks like SR 11-7 and Basel guidelines are typically required. Strong analytical thinking, attention to detail, and effective communication skills help you interpret model results and convey complex findings to stakeholders. These competencies ensure models are robust, compliant, and transparent, safeguarding the organization's financial stability and regulatory standing.

What are the typical challenges faced by a credit risk model validation quantitative analyst when reviewing complex financial models?

Credit Risk Model Validation Quantitative Analysts often encounter challenges such as interpreting complex model methodologies, ensuring data integrity, and identifying model limitations or weaknesses. They must thoroughly assess both conceptual soundness and technical implementation, which can involve dissecting highly sophisticated quantitative techniques and large datasets. Collaboration with model developers and business stakeholders is essential to address findings, communicate technical issues clearly, and ensure regulatory compliance. Staying current with evolving regulatory standards and best practices is also a key aspect of the role.

Job description

Title: Model Risk Analyst - Validation [Multiple Positions Available]
Job Location: 345 Main St, Buffalo, NY 14203. Position requires in-office work four (4) days every week.
Job Description: Perform independent validation review of complex financial statistical models with primary focus on Treasury models (including interest rates sensitive, interest rates and currency derivatives models), as well as Fair Lending and general Credit Risk models. Writing quality reports for management review. Preparing materials and leading Effective Challenge presentations of accomplished validations. Supporting MRM model life cycle in relations to reviewing and reporting of IRA, MCA, MCM, MRT. Establishing communication with model owners, model developers, model stakeholders in support of successful model validation process and MRM initiatives. Supporting development of playbook for Validation of Fair Lending Models. Coordinate the engagement of third parties to perform validation. Review the results of third party validation. Perform validation and analysis of expert judgment or qualitative factors that augment quantitative models. Review to confirm proper controls and adequate documentation are in place. Recommend, as necessary, the cessation of reliance on models that are outdated or inaccurate, as determined by analysis. Prepare reporting for Management to monitor performance of models. Participate in meetings with model owners to discuss current portfolio tracking and business observations. Develop knowledge on standard concepts, practices, and procedures within the model validation/risk analytics field. Mine data from a variety of sources. Utilize technical skills to manage data and efficiently conduct analyses. Develop ad hoc processes to address efficiency gains that translate into repeatable procedures. Prepare written summary and analysis of all validation work, using a combination of word processing and presentation software skills. Adhere to applicable compliance/operational risk controls in accordance with Company or regulatory standards and policies. Maintain M&T internal control standards, including timely implementation of internal and external audit points together with any issues raised by external regulators as applicable.
Minimum requirements: Master's degree (or foreign equivalent) in Financial Mathematics, Mathematics, Statistics, Computer Science, Operation Research, Econometrics, or a related technical field plus three (3) years of experience in the job offered or as a Model Risk Analyst, Quantitative Model Developer, Quantitative Financial Analyst, Statistician, Data Scientist, or Model Validator. The employer will alternatively accept a Bachelor's degree (or foreign equivalent) in Financial Mathematics, Mathematics, Statistics, Computer Science, Operation Research, Econometrics, or related technical field plus six (6) years of experience in the job offered or as Quantitative Model Developer, Quantitative Financial Analyst, Statistician, Data Scientist, or Model Validator.
Requires three (3) years of experience in each of the following:
• Statistical modeling techniques including regression (including linear, logistic, Poisson, lasso, and ridge), machine learning (including tree and XGBoost), and cluster analysis.
• Programming skills in Python or SAS.
• Work with supervised models (including regressions, boosting, and ensemble learning) and unsupervised algorithms (including clustering and DBSCAN) applied to quantitative risk modeling and data-driven analysis.
• Statistical theory, including sampling methods, confidence intervals, and hypothesis testing for evaluating model assumptions and performance.
• Programming languages including Python or SAS for statistical modeling, machine learning development, implementation, future engineering and model performance evaluation.
• Writing reproducible code.
• Data wrangling, automation, and generating analytical reports.
• Leveraging SQL and other query languages to query, transform, and preprocess structured and unstructured data for analytical and modeling purposes.
• Working with data mining and feature engineering techniques.
